We are looking for a Data Implementation Analyst to join CooperSurgical and help build Embryo Options the first business of its kind to help guide patients through the process of storing cryopreserved embryos eggs and sperm. Embryo Options partners with IVF centers to educate and assist fertility patients with making disposition decisions for their cryopreserved tissue. The IVF center and Embryo Options partnership enables patients to conveniently pay storage fees online as well as gain access to comprehensive educational content and the worlds largest embryo donation platform.
As more and more patients are freezing embryos eggs and sperm our goal is to provide tools to fertility clinics that help their patients to navigate the complicated financial legal and ethical issues associated with cryopreservation.
As a Data Analyst on the Embryo Options Customer Success you will Own the integrity usability and structure of customer data throughout the implementation and ongoing reporting. This individual serves as the bridge between raw data internal systems and customer facing outcomes while continuously improving data hygiene and reporting processes.
You Will:
- Own data ingestion validation and transformation processes
- Clean analyze and transform clinic cryo-storage data from disparate unstructured sources like Excel Microsoft Access SQL databases and CSV
- Work closely with our Customer Success team to communicate any data issues back to IVF clinics and EMR providers
- Provide clear reproducible analysis to help answer business questions for IVF centers and our product team
- Collaborate with our product team to identify new application features that help IVF centers better understand their patient data
- Act as data lead during customer implementations by maintaining clear documentation and timelines for data related workstreams
- Partner directly with customers to understand current data structures diagnose quality issues and set expectations on reporting capabilities.
- Help define standards for clean data documentation and identify opportunities for automation
